山本です。始めまして。
今 FreeBSD 4.4 + Apache + Ruby(mod_ruby) + PostgreSQL (+ Java) + qmail で
立体写真とステレオグラムのホームページを作っています。アンケートなどを
<form method="post" action="mailto:.... で送ってもらい、集計をしています。
これを Ruby を使って自動化することを目論んでいます。
メールを net/pop の以下のテストプログラムで読み込むと、
自分のメールボックスのメールを見ることは出来るのですが、
delete で消すことが出来ません。何回実行しても同じメールが表示されます。
同じプログラムで vaio.ne.jp、gol.com にあるメールは
ちゃんと消すことができますし、AL-mail で qmail のメールを取り込むと
ちゃんと取り込んだメールは消してくれます。
以下のプログラムと qmail (Maildir形式) でメールが消えないことで
何か参考になることや、調べたらよいことなどを教えていただければと思い
ポストしました。
よろしくお願いします。
-----------------------------------------------------
#!/usr/local/bin/ruby -Ke
require "net/pop";
pop = Net::POP.new('localhost');
pop.start('stereo', 'nojima.satsuki.');
msg = pop.mails[0];
msg.all($stdout);
msg.delete!;
----
T.Yamamoto rcn / gol.com http://rcn.dhs.org/